[01:10] [peer] Neodymium magnets are extremely strong, and must be handled with care to avoid personal injury and damage to the magnets. Fingers and other body parts can get severely pinched between two attracting magnets.
[01:10] [peer] Neodymium magnets are brittle, and can peel, crack or shatter if allowed to slam together. Eye protection should be worn when handling these magnets, because shattering magnets can launch pieces at great speeds.

[06:17] [intricatic] one server splits from the main network and all users on that server go with it
[06:17] [raddmadd] yeah
[06:17] [intricatic] it splits due to excessive latency between servers
[06:17] [raddmadd] hi jaq
[06:17] [raddmadd] ahh okay.
[06:17] [intricatic] hi jaq
[06:17] [jaq] OK
[06:17] [raddmadd] lol
[06:18] [intricatic] so the server might not go down, per se, but it goes off the network and creates it's own isolated network group (if other servers go with it, for instance)
